P140, P142 = 10: Output will energize if
motor load falls below the P145 value longer
than the P146 time

If P150 = 1 or 2, sets the frequency at which
output equals 10 VDC
500
If P150 = 3 or 4, sets the Load (as a percent of
drive current rating) at which output equals
10 VDC.
1000
If P150 = 5 or 6, sets the Torque (as a percent
of motor rated torque) at which output
equals 10 VDC
200.0
If P150 = 7 or 8, sets the power at which
output equals 10 VDC
